In the Shadow

In the Shadow

In director David Ondříček’s film, “In the Shadow,” a simple jewelry store heist unravels a larger Cold War conspiracy against Czechoslovakian Jews. The story takes the form of a noir political thriller, and was the Czech Republic’s official entry for the Best Foreign Language Film Oscar for the 85th Academy Awards. Keep Rockland Beautiful’s Cleanup Campaign Kicks Off in New City

Keep Rockland Beautiful’s Cleanup Campaign Kicks Off in New City

BY BARRY WARNER Keep Rockland Beautiful, in partnership with The Great American Cleanup, is a nonprofit organization that leads efforts to clean up, beautify and protect Rockland County’s environment. FASNY LAUNCHES FIRST EVER “SECTIONAL CHALLENGE” AS PART OF RECRUITNY INITIATIVE

As part of its upcoming RecruitNY campaign, the Firemen’s Association of the State of New York (FASNY) has launched a first-of-its kind “Sectional Challenge,” which tracks fire department recruitment efforts throughout the state.
